>>seems like (some of ) the mem manufacturers ( like kingston,
>>viking(?) are saying that the mem specific to the lx164 has
>>been discontinued. But I keep on seeing that the PC100 ECC CS2
>>chips are still available (buffering is not mentioned ) . Am I
>>missing something from getting mo' mem for my machine ?
>>
>>
>
>I can tell you for certain that Crucial ECC unbuffered PC100
>works just fine in a PC164LX. Other brands I do not know so
>much about, but I've heard tell that generic ECC unbuffered
>PC100 works too.
